BSDPORTAL.RU

На этом сайте обсуждаются вопросы использования ОС FreeBSD
 Портал  •  Статьи  •  Форум  •  Wiki  •  Поиск  •  FAQ  •  Обои  •   Официальная документация  •  Новые темы 

Часовой пояс: UTC + 4 часа




Начать новую тему Ответить на тему  [ Сообщений: 4 ] 
Автор Сообщение
 Заголовок сообщения: postfix. Несколько IP
СообщениеДобавлено: Пт 20 июн, 2014 1:48 pm 
Не в сети

Зарегистрирован: Чт 07 окт, 2004 6:12 pm
Сообщения: 191
Подскажите как реализовать следующее:

Необходимо научить postfix работать с несколькими исходящими IP
Как это можно реализовать?

Наткнулся на эту статейку. вроде то что нужно, но что-то в ней смущает. Посоветовался с коллегой он говорит что будет будет тормозить система при таком раскладе, так как для каждого письма будет компиляться перловый скрипт.

Может есть еще идеи?


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: postfix. Несколько IP
СообщениеДобавлено: Пт 20 июн, 2014 2:31 pm 
Не в сети
Модератор

Зарегистрирован: Сб 11 сен, 2004 6:33 am
Сообщения: 5115
Откуда: Москва
arriah писал(а):
Посоветовался с коллегой он говорит что будет будет тормозить система при таком раскладе, так как для каждого письма будет компиляться перловый скрипт.

Я не сильно хорошо знаю postfix, но насколько я понял, скрипт запускается не на каждое письмо, а на каждое tcp соединение, и можно предположить что postfix достаточно умный чтобы не плодить по соединению на каждое письмо (что к базе, что к tcp), а держать их пул. В документации наскидку про это не нашёл, но это можно легко проверить, логгируя факты запуска скрипта.

В любом случае, как и в любых задачах касающихся производительности, вопрос в том, достаточно ли велик поток писем чтобы компиляция скрипта хоть бы и на каждое письмо на что-то влияла и вообще была заметна. В случае если это действительно узкое место, скрипт всегда можно переписать на C.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: postfix. Несколько IP
СообщениеДобавлено: Пт 04 июл, 2014 3:57 pm 
Не в сети

Зарегистрирован: Чт 07 окт, 2004 6:12 pm
Сообщения: 191
Извините за долгое молчание. Спасибо за ответ.
Это надо было для организации множественной рассылки (не спам, просто много клиентов).
Проблема решилась просто - использование SPF и DKIM

дабы не плодить тему:
К postfix прикручена вэб морда - roundcube. Все нормально работает. Но есть небольшие траблы с кодировкой, в частности в кирилическом имени аттача.
То есть если все в KOI8-R проблем не наблюдается, а вот есть в UTF-8, то все письмо читаемо нормально, а вот название аттача, например из "МВидеоТОРГ12.xls", превращается в "Часть 2.2.xls". а иногда вобще не пойми во что.
В настройках кубика полазил, выставил кодировка в соответтсвии с RFC 2047 - не помогло. RFC 2231 тоже не помогает.
Может кто сталкивался? Есть решение?


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: postfix. Несколько IP
СообщениеДобавлено: Пт 04 июл, 2014 7:01 pm 
Не в сети

Зарегистрирован: Чт 07 окт, 2004 6:12 pm
Сообщения: 191
Вот в "проблемных" письмах в заголовках вот что:
Цитата:
Content-disposition: attachment;
filename*1*=utf-8''%D0%9C%D0%92%D0%B8%D0%B4%D0%B5%D0%BE;
filename*2*=%D0%A2%D0%9E%D0%A0%D0%93%31%32%2E%78%6C%73


Отправлял письма в UTF-8 со своего сервера, в заголовках:
Цитата:
Content-Disposition: attachment;
filename="=?UTF-8?Q?=D0=B7=D0=B0=D0=B3=D1=80=D1=83=D0=B6=D0=B5=D0=BD=D0?=
=?UTF-8?Q?=BE=2Edoc?=";


Почему такое разное кодирование? в первом случае через %, во втором через =


Вернуться к началу
 Профиль  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 4 ] 

Часовой пояс: UTC + 4 часа


Кто сейчас на конференции

Зарегистрированные пользователи: Bing [Bot], Google [Bot], Majestic-12 [Bot]


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Создано на основе phpBB® Forum Software © phpBB Group
Русская поддержка phpBB
Яндекс.Метрика